He came onto the scene in 1945 in the acclaimed 1945 film '' La cabalgata del circo'' in which he starred alongside two of the biggest names in Argentine cinema in the day, Libertad Lamarque and Hugo del Carril. In 1947 he then starred in another classic, A sangre fría, which also starred Amelia Bence. He died of cancer in 2001.
